Aims and Scope
Since its launch in 1946 by P. M. Doty, H. Mark, and C.C. Price, the Journal of Polymer Science has served the community as a forum for fundamental research on synthesis, chemistry, physics, and engineering of polymers. It ever evolved into a few sister journals to pace the development rhythm of polymer science.
From January 2020, the Journal of Polymer Science, Part A: Polymer Chemistry and Journal of Polymer Science, Part B: Polymer Physics are published as the single original title, the Journal of Polymer Science. It aims to provide a unified, inclusive, and dynamic forum for this rapidly developing multidisciplinary area. With a continuous value deemed to the chemistry, physics and engineering of polymers, it will extend its coverage to all aspects of polymer studies.
The Journal of Polymer Science has a 2021 partial Impact Factor of 3.046 (Journal Citation Reports (Clarivate Analytics, 2022)).
